If memory serves me correctly, msmsgsin.exe either installed or launched the
Windows messenger 4.7 executable, msmsgs.exe.


I know that you could kill both of them off to get rid of Windows Messenger.
Worked for a company that wanted to cut over from WM and Exchange to MSN IM
(MSN forced an automatic update of the client...which was incompatible with
Exchange IM), but we did not want to sneakernet and uninstall WM...so I
wrote a script to hit every workstation in the domain, kill the processes
(if they were up), and rename the files. If the files did not exist it went
to the next machine...ad nauseum.
